Oysters with Shallots and Red Wine Vinegar
Finely chop 1 peeled shallot and mix with 2 heaped teaspoons of sugar, 6 tablespoons of red wine vinegar and a little pepper. Allow to sit for 10 minutes. Serve in a dish with the oysters.

Oysters with Chilli, Ginger and Rice Wine Vinegar
Finely grate 1/2 a thumb-sized piece of peeled ginger and mix with 6 tablespoons of rice wine vinegar, 1 finely chopped and deseeded red chilli, and a little finely sliced fresh coriander. Stir in a teaspoon of sugar until dissolved. Serve in a dish with the oysters.
